I am very intrigued by these statements about aggressive CB blood pythons. I have been working with them since the early 1980's and have kept and/or been around hundreds of them. While the wildcaughts I've been around typically had attitudes, I would have to say that less than 5% of the captive borns showed aggressive behavior. However, I do not have experience with the farmed bloods coming in from Indonesia, which would be my guess on the origin of this pair of babies. Was wondering what everyone's impression was of these farmed specimens. Thanks,
